Resetting Data

You can reset the elevation data and the maximum
elevation data by selecting these options from the

Reset Page.

To reset the elevation data and max
elevation fields:
1. Press MENU to open the Altimeter Page
Options Menu.
2. Highlight Reset, and press ENTER to open the
Reset Page.
3. Use the ROCKER to highlight a reset option,
and then press ENTER to place a check
mark in the box next to the selected item. You
can reset elevation data such as Minimum
Elevation, all Ascent and Descent data, or only
the Maximum Elevation.

4. Highlight the Apply button, and press ENTER
to reset the data fields. A confirmation
message appears.
You can reset or delete data for any of the
other features represented on the list by
placing a check mark in the box next to the
item.
5. Highlight Apply, and press ENTER to reset
the selected options.
6. To reset all categories shown on the page,
highlight Select All, and press ENTER. Then
repeat step 5 above.
